July 7, 2009 - PRLog -- "Lovely Lady", built in 1930 by Nevins of City Island, NY famous for their America's cup yachts and, the only one of her type, was in mid-restoration at the time of this horrific incident, and much had been invested rebuilding her decks, superstructure, and the forward portion of her hull.  Since the interior had been removed prior to the starting the restoration, it was not affected.   Engineers report that the newly rebuilt engines and generators will survive if treated as soon as the yacht is raised, as it is resting in fresh water.

The yacht has appeared in numerous Hollywood films from the '50's to 1988's "Tequila Sunrise", starring Mel Gibson, Michelle Pfieffer, and Kurt Russel.  She has witnessed some great moments in history, as the meeting place of The Univac Corporation, at the dawn of the computer age.  It was the Remington-Rand Corporation (later Sperry-Rand) that propelled Univac into history, and our "Lovely Lady" was the yacht of the company's CEO, the retired US Army General Douglas MacArthur.  Also, Marilyn Monroe was reported to have stayed aboard her during the filming of "Some Like it Hot" in 1958, at San Diego's Coranado hotel.
